Transaction 64d7a2f7eb9c4fe650b5260dfc2e3d17fde585e41be7191baf01389e17fec378

3 Input
1 Outputs
  • 64d7a2f7eb9c4fe650b5260dfc2e3d17fde585e41be7191baf01389e17fec378:0
  • value  33321810
    address  38co7nnHTj9JknBhXVi1Eb89QqRAs61oQB